ELECTRONICS Voice Command Tips • Speaking complete names (i.e; Call John Doe vs. Call John) will result in greater system accuracy. • You can "link" commands together for faster results. Say "Call John Doe, mobile," for example. • If you are listening to available voice command options, you do not have to listen to the entire list. When you hear the command that you need, push the button on the steering wheel, wait for the beep and say your command. Changing The Volume • Start a dialogue by pushing the Phone button example - "Help". , then say a command for • Use the radio VOLUME/MUTE rotary knob to adjust the volume to a comfortable level while the Uconnect® system is speaking. Please note the volume setting for Uconnect® is different than the audio system. NOTE: To access help, push the Uconnect® Phone button say "help."
